Library membership is free and you can even join online. Next time you visit the library, bring your photo ID and proof of name and address to receive your library card.

​​​​​​​​​​​​Under Council's Library Services Policy, which came into effect on 1 July 2018, parents/guardians of children under 12 years of age must remain on library premises. Anyone under 16 years of age must have a parent authority to join the library. For more details, download our Library Services Policy.

Lost cards can be replaced at a cost of $5 with photo ID/ proof of name and address.

24-hour return facilities are available at Campsie, Bankstown, Riverwood and Chester Hill Library and Knowledge Centres. An after-hours return chute is available at Lakemba Library and Knowledge Centre.
